Woman’s call leads police to body of husband

Summary by Keizertimes
The call to police came on a Friday morning. “I just wanted to report that I killed my husband two days ago and his body is at our house,” the caller said. That call on July 17 led Keizer police to a North Cummings Lane home, where a detective used a drone to scout the two-story house. In an upstairs bedroom, they discovered the body of Walter Peca, 59.
